#Bayanihan
Pronounced like "buy-uh-nee-hun," bayanihan is a Filipino word derived from the word bayan meaning town, nation, or community in general. "Bayanihan" literally means, "being a bayan," and is thus used to refer to a spirit of communal unity and cooperation.

This is a "house moving tradition" in the Philippines. In the past and in some areas up to now in the Philippines "Bayanihan" is shown by helping families carry their house from one place to another.
